New phone directory entries

To create a new phone directory entry

Press MENU twice to select DIRECTORY. Press Vto highlight STORE. Press SELECT, then enter the telephone number when prompted.

Use the dial pad to enter up to 32 digits, then press SELECT. You will be notified if the number is already in your phone directory.

To insert a number from your redial list, press REDIAL, then ^Vto find the number, then press SELECT.

Press DELETE to erase numbers if you make a mistake.

Press and hold PAUSE to enter a 3-second dialing pause.

To enter a name

Press dial pad buttons once for the first letter, twice for the second, three times for the third. Continue for lower-case letters or numerals.

Press once to enter “A” (5 times for “a”). Press twice to enter “B” (6 times for “b”).

2 Press 3 times to enter “C” (7 times for “c”). Press 4 times to enter “2”.

The cursor moves to the right when you press another dial pad button or the ^button. Press Vto move the cursor to the left. Press 1to enter a space, or press twice to enter “1”.

Press DELETE to erase letters if you make a mistake.

Press *repeatedly to enter an asterisk (*), question mark (?), exclamation point (!), slash (/) or parentheses.

Press #repeatedly to enter a pound sign (#), apostrophe ('), comma (,) hyphen (-), period (.), or ampersand (&).

Storing the entry

Press SELECT to store your new phone directory entry. To change it later, see page 23.
